What’s a raspberry lime rickey?

Therickey has a long history as a drink! It was first invented as the Gin Rickey in the 1890’s, made with gin, soda water and lime juice. (Well, technically before that it started with bourbon in the 1880’s!) The drink rose to worldwide popularity, and is even mentioned in books like the 1920’s novelGreat Gatsby. TheLime Rickeyis a mocktail spin that loses the gin, though some people slip gin into any rickey recipe (including us!).

What’s soda water? Is it the same as tonic water?

Soda water is not the same as tonic water: and it’s essential to a rickey! Here’s the difference between the two:

  • Soda water, aka sparkling water or seltzer,is carbonated water with no additives (opt for plain, since sometimes flavors or sugars can be added). We use our SodaStream to make soda water for drinks, and just for drinking.
  • Tonic wateris carbonated water with added quinine and sugar. It will make a noticeably different flavor in this drink since it’s sweeter and has a bitter finish.

Ingredients

Scale

  • 1 ounce (2 tablespoons) fresh lime juice
  • ½ ounce raspberry syrup (purchased or homemade*)
  • For a co*cktail: 2 ounces gin (optional)
  • 4 ounces (½ cup) soda water
  • For serving: Ice (try clear ice), lime wedges, fresh raspberries

Instructions

  1. Add the lime juice, optional gin, and syrup to highball glass and stir.
  2. Fill with ice and top with sparkling water. Garnish with lime wedges and fresh raspberries.

Who invented the lime rickey? ›

The Lime Rickey was born of thinking outside the box. It got its name from the Rickey, an austere Washington, D.C., co*cktail composed of whiskey or gin, lime juice, and soda water. It was invented by bartender George Williamson at Shoomaker's bar and dubbed for a sport named “Colonel” Joe Rickey.

What is the difference between a gimlet and a Rickey? ›

A Rickey is a gimlet with soda water and a sour is a gimlet with sugar added (and a sidecar is actually a sour with triple sec). If the drink has both sugar and soda water than it is a Collins.

What are highball co*cktails? ›

A highball is a mixed alcoholic drink composed of an alcoholic base spirit and a larger proportion of a non-alcoholic mixer, often a carbonated beverage.
